## Recipe 1: Roasted Asparagus with Lemon-Garlic Vinaigrette
This simple yet elegant side dish is a perfect example of Julia Kramer’s emphasis on fresh, seasonal ingredients and balanced flavors. The roasted asparagus is tender and slightly sweet, while the lemon-garlic vinaigrette adds a bright and tangy counterpoint.
**Ingredients:**
* 1 pound asparagus, trimmed
* 2 tablespoons olive oil
* 2 cloves garlic, minced
* 2 tablespoons lemon juice
* 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
* 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
*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
**Instructions:**
1. **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).** Preparing the oven ensures that the asparagus will roast evenly and quickly.
2. **Prepare the asparagus:** Wash the asparagus thoroughly. Snap off the tough ends of the asparagus spears. This will ensure that only the tender parts are used. Toss the trimmed asparagus with 1 tablespoon of olive oil, salt, and pepper on a baking sheet. Ensure the asparagus spears are spread in a single layer for even cooking.
3. **Roast the asparagus:** Roast in the preheated oven for 10-15 minutes, or until the asparagus is tender-crisp and slightly browned. The exact roasting time will depend on the thickness of the asparagus spears. Check frequently to avoid overcooking.
4. **Prepare the vinaigrette:** While the asparagus is roasting, prepare the lemon-garlic vinaigrette. In a small bowl, whisk together the minced garlic,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il, salt, and pepper. Whisk until the ingredients are well combined and emulsified.
5. **Assemble the dish:** Once the asparagus is roasted, transfer it to a serving platter. Drizzle the lemon-garlic vinaigrette over the asparagus.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ley.
6. **Serve immediately.** This dish is best served warm or at room temperature. The bright flavors of the lemon-garlic vinaigrette complement the tender asparagus perfectly.
**Tips and Variations:**
* For a richer flavor, add a sprinkle of grated Parmesan cheese to the asparagus before roasting.
* You can substitute other vegetables for the asparagus, such as broccoli, Brussels sprouts, or green beans. Adjust the roasting time accordingly.
*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the vinaigrette for a touch of heat.
* To enhance the garlic flavor, gently sauté the minced garlic in a little olive oil before adding it to the vinaigrette.
* Experiment with different herbs in the vinaigrette, such as thyme, rosemary, or chives.
## Recipe 2: Pan-Seared Salmon with Sautéed Spinach and Lemon Butter Sauce
This elegant and flavorful dish is perfect for a weeknight dinner or a special occasion. The salmon is perfectly seared to a crispy skin and tender flesh, while the sautéed spinach adds a healthy and flavorful side. The lemon butter sauce ties everything together with its bright and tangy richness.
**Ingredients:**
* 2 (6-ounce) salmon fillets, skin on
*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
* 2 tablespoons olive oil
* 4 cups fresh spinach
* 2 cloves garlic, minced
* 2 tablespoons butter
* 2 tablespoons lemon juice
* 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
**Instructions:**
1. **Prepare the salmon:** Pat the salmon fillets dry with paper towels. Season both sides with salt and pepper. Drying the salmon ensures a crispier skin when searing.
2. **Sear the salmon:**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once the oil is hot, place the salmon fillets skin-side down in the skillet. Sear for 5-7 minutes, or until the skin is crispy and golden brown. Flip the salmon and cook for another 3-5 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through. The cooking time will depend on the thickness of the salmon fillets. Use a fish spatula to carefully flip the salmon.
3. **Sauté the spinach:** While the salmon is cooking, sauté the spinach. Heat the rem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a separate skillet over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and cook for 30 seconds, or until fragrant. Add the spinach and cook until it wilts, about 2-3 minutes. Stir frequently to ensure even cooking.
4. **Make the lemon butter sauce:** In a small saucepan, melt the butter over low heat. Stir in the lemon juice and chopped fresh parsley.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Keep the sauce warm over low heat.
5. **Assemble the dish:** Place the sautéed spinach on a plate. Top with the seared salmon fillet. Drizzle with the lemon butter sauce.
6. **Serve immediately.** This dish is best served warm. The crispy salmon skin, tender flesh, and bright lemon butter sauce create a symphony of flavors.
**Tips and Variations:**
* For a richer flavor, use clarified butter to sear the salmon.
*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the lemon butter sauce for a touch of heat.
* You can substitute kale or other leafy greens for the spinach.
* To enhance the flavor of the salmon, marinate it in a mixture of soy sauce, ginger, and garlic for 30 minutes before searing.
* Serve with a side of roasted potatoes or rice for a complete meal.
## Recipe 3: Lemon Ricotta Pancakes with Berry Compote
These light and fluffy pancakes are a delightful treat for breakfast or brunch. The ricotta cheese adds a creamy richness, while the lemon zest brightens the flavor. The berry compote is a sweet and tangy complement to the pancakes.
**Ingredients (Pancakes):**
* 1 cup all-purpose flour
* 2 tablespoons sugar
* 2 teaspoons baking powder
* 1/4 teaspoon salt
* 1 cup ricotta cheese
* 1 cup milk
* 2 large eggs
* 2 tablespoons melted butter
* 1 teaspoon lemon zest
**Ingredients (Berry Compote):**
* 1 cup mixed berries (fresh or frozen)
* 2 tablespoons sugar
* 1 tablespoon lemon juice
**Instructions (Pancakes):**
1. **Combine dry ingredients:** In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t. Whisking ensures the dry ingredients are evenly distributed.
2. **Combine wet ingredients:** In a separate bowl, whisk together the ricotta cheese, milk, eggs, melted butter, and lemon zest. Make sure the ricotta is smooth before mixing.
3. **Combine wet and dry ingredients:** Gently fold the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ients until just combined. Do not overmix. A few lumps are okay. Overmixing will result in tough pancakes.
4. **Cook the pancakes:** Heat a lightly oiled griddle or skillet over medium heat. Pour 1/4 cup of batter onto the hot griddle for each pancake. Cook for 2-3 minutes per side, or until golden brown and cooked through. Flip the pancakes when bubbles start to form on the surface.
5. **Keep warm:** Keep the cooked pancakes warm in a preheated oven (200°F or 95°C) until ready to serve.
**Instructions (Berry Compote):**
1. **Combine ingredients:** In a small saucepan, combine the mixed berries, sugar, and lemon juice.
2. **Cook the compote:** C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until the berries soften and release their juices, about 5-7 minutes. If using frozen berries, cook for a slightly longer time.
3. **Simmer until thickened:** Reduce the heat to low and simmer for another 5-10 minutes, or until the compote has thickened to your desired consistency.
4. **Let cool slightly:** Remove from heat and let the compote cool slightly before serving. The compote will thicken further as it cools.
**Assemble the dish:**
1. Stack the lemon ricotta pancakes on a plate.
2. Spoon the berry compote over the pancakes.
3. Serve immediately. Enjoy the delightful combination of fluffy pancakes and sweet berry compote.
**Tips and Variations:**
* For extra fluffy pancakes, separate the eggs and whisk the egg whites until stiff peaks form.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the batter at the end.
* Add a sprinkle of cinnamon or nutmeg to the pancake batter for a warm and spicy flavor.
* You can substitute other fruits for the berries in the compote, such as peaches, apples, or pears.
* Drizzle with maple syrup or a dusting of powdered sugar for added sweetness.
* For a richer flavor, use brown butter instead of regular melted butter in the pancake batter.
## Recipe 4: Grilled Chicken with Peach and Arugula Salad
This light and refreshing salad is perfect for a summer lunch or dinner. The grilled chicken is tender and flavorful, while the peaches add a touch of sweetness and the arugula provides a peppery bite. The balsamic vinaigrette ties everything together with its tangy acidity.
**Ingredients:**
* 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
*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
* 2 tablespoons olive oil
* 2 ripe peaches, pitted and sliced
* 4 cups arugula
* 1/4 cup crumbled goat cheese
* 1/4 cup toasted pecans
**Ingredients (Balsamic Vinaigrette):**
* 3 tablespoons olive oil
* 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
* 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
* 1 clove garlic, minced
*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
**Instructions:**
1. **Prepare the chicken:**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els. Season both sides with salt and pepper. Pound the chicken breasts to an even thickness for even cooking.
2. **Grill the chicken:** Preheat a grill to medium-high heat. Brush the grill grates with olive oil. Grill the chicken breasts for 5-7 minutes per side, or until cooked through. The internal temperature of the chicken should reach 165°F (74°C).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before slicing.
3. **Prepare the balsamic vinaigrette:** In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, balsamic vinegar, Dijon mustard, minced garlic, salt, and pepper. Whisk until the ingredients are well combined and emulsified.
4. **Assemble the Salad**: In a large bowl, combine the arugula, sliced peaches, crumbled goat cheese, and toasted pecans.
5. **Slice the chicken:** Slice the grilled chicken breasts thinly.
6. **Assemble the dish:** Add the sliced chicken to the salad. Drizzle with the balsamic vinaigrette. Gently toss to combine.
7. **Serve immediately.** This salad is best served fresh. The combination of flavors and textures is truly delightful.
**Tips and Variations:**
* Marinate the chicken in a mixture of ol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, and herbs for at least 30 minutes before grilling for added flavor.
* Use a grill pan or indoor grill if you don’t have access to an outdoor grill.
* You can substitute other fruits for the peaches, such as nectarines, plums, or berries.
* Add grilled corn kernels or cherry tomatoes to the salad for added sweetness and color.
* Substitute feta cheese or blue cheese for the goat cheese.
* Use walnuts or almonds instead of pecans.
## Recipe 5: Creamy Tomato Soup with Grilled Cheese Croutons
This classic comfort food is elevated with the addition of grilled cheese croutons. The creamy tomato soup is rich and flavorful, while the grilled cheese croutons add a crispy, cheesy, and satisfying crunch.
**Ingredients (Tomato Soup):**
* 2 tablespoons olive oil
* 1 onion, chopped
* 2 cloves garlic, minced
* 2 (28-ounce) cans crushed tomatoes
* 4 cups vegetable broth
* 1 teaspoon sugar
* 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
*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
* 1/2 cup heavy cream (optional)
**Ingredients (Grilled Cheese Croutons):**
* 4 slices bread
* 2 tablespoons butter, softened
* 4 slices cheddar cheese
**Instructions (Tomato Soup):**
1. **Sauté the onion and garlic:**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ook until softened, about 5-7 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for another 30 seconds, or until fragrant. Stir frequently to prevent burning.
2. **Add tomatoes and broth:** Add the crushed tomatoes, vegetable broth, sugar, and oregano to the pot.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Stir well to combine.
3. **Simmer the soup:** Bring the soup to a simmer. Reduce the heat to low and simmer for 20-30 minutes, stirring occasionally. Simmering allows the flavors to meld together.
4. **Blend the soup:** Use an immersion blender to blend the soup until smooth. Alternatively, you can carefully transfer the soup to a regular blender in batches and blend until smooth. Be cautious when blending hot liquids.
5. **Add cream (optional):** If desired, stir in the heavy cream for a richer and creamier soup.
**Instructions (Grilled Cheese Croutons):**
1. **Prepare the sandwiches:** Spread butter on one side of each slice of bread. Place two slices of cheese between two slices of bread, butter-side out.
2. **Grill the sandwiches:** Heat a skillet over medium heat. Grill the sandwiches for 2-3 minutes per side, or until golden brown and the cheese is melted.
3. **Cut Into Croutons**: Remove from skillet and slice each sandwich into small squares.
**Assemble the dish:**
1. Ladle the creamy tomato soup into bowls.
2. Top with grilled cheese croutons.
3. Serve immediately. The combination of warm soup and crispy croutons is incredibly satisfying.
**Tips and Variations:**
*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the soup for a touch of heat.
* Roast the tomatoes before adding them to the soup for a deeper and more complex flavor.
* Use different types of cheese for the grilled cheese croutons, such as Gruyere, Swiss, or Monterey Jack.
* Add a swirl of pesto or a dollop of sour cream to the soup for added flavor and richness.
* Garnish with fresh basil leaves or a drizzle of olive oil.
## Mastering Julia Kramer’s Techniques
Beyond the specific recipes, it’s important to understand the techniques that Julia Kramer employs in her cooking. Mastering these techniques will allow you to adapt her recipes to your own preferences and create your own culinary masterpieces.
* **Proper Knife Skills:** Developing good knife skills is essential for efficient and consistent cooking. Learn how to properly hold a knife and practice different cutting techniques, such as dicing, mincing, and julienning.
* **Searing Techniques:** Searing food at high heat creates a flavorful crust and locks in moisture. Make sure your pan is hot before adding the food, and avoid overcrowding the pan.
* **Roasting Techniques:** Roasting is a versatile cooking method that brings out the natural sweetness of vegetables and adds depth of flavor to meats. Preheat your oven to the correct temperature and arrange the food in a single layer on the baking sheet.
* **Sauce Making:** Mastering basic sauce-making techniques is crucial for adding flavor and complexity to your dishes. Learn how to make classic sauces, such as béchamel, velouté, and tomato sauce.
* **Flavor Balancing:** Understanding how to balance sweet, sour, salty, bitter, and umami flavors is key to creating delicious and harmonious dishes. Experiment with different combinations of ingredients and seasonings to find what works best for you.
